2. How Can Blockchain Improve Business Security?

Security remains one of the primary reasons enterprises adopt blockchain technology. Unlike traditional databases, blockchain stores information across multiple nodes, making unauthorized alterations extremely difficult.

Key security benefits include:

  • Immutable transaction records

  • Advanced cryptographic protection

  • Decentralized data storage

  • Reduced risk of cyberattacks

  • Improved identity verification

These capabilities help businesses safeguard sensitive information and reduce security vulnerabilities.

9. What Is the Difference Between Public and Private Blockchains?

Public blockchains are open networks where anyone can participate and validate transactions.

Private blockchains restrict access to approved participants and offer greater control over data and governance.

Most enterprises prefer private or consortium blockchain networks because they provide:

  • Better privacy

  • Faster performance

  • Regulatory compliance

  • Enhanced operational control

10. How Do Smart Contracts Benefit Businesses?

Smart contracts are self-executing digital agreements that automatically perform actions when predefined conditions are met.

Benefits include:

  • Reduced manual intervention

  • Faster transaction processing

  • Improved accuracy

  • Lower operational costs

  • Increased transparency

Smart contracts are widely used in finance, insurance, supply chain management, and real estate.
